What are office managers?

Office manag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the daily administrative operations of an office. They ensure that the workplace runs efficiently by managing office supplies, coordinating schedules, supervising administrative staff, and implementing procedures to improve workflow. Office managers also handle tasks such as budgeting, organizing meetings, and maintaining office equipment. Their role is crucial in supporting other staff members and ensuring that the office environment is productive and well-organized.

What Does an Office Manager Do?

An Office Manager is responsible for keeping their office running smoothly. They assign work to administrative assistants, update records, and arrange travel and conference room schedules. Office Managers perform clerical tasks such as answering phone calls, responding to correspondence, and organizing appointments and meetings. Other duties include monitoring and delivering mail and maintaining office equipment like computers and printers.

How does an Office Manager typically interact with other departments within an organization?

Office Managers play a central role in facilitating communication and coordination between different departments. They often serve as the primary point of contact for administrative needs, ensuring that teams have the resources and support necessary for smooth operations. Office Managers may collaborate with HR on onboarding new staff, work with finance on budgeting and purchasing, and assist IT with equipment or infrastructure requests. This cross-departmental interaction requires strong organizational and interpersonal skills, making the role ideal for those who enjoy varied tasks and teamwork.

What is the difference between Office Manager vs Administrative Assistant?

AspectOffice ManagerAdministrative Assistant
Primary RoleOversees office operations, manages staff, and implements policiesProvides administrative support, manages schedules, and handles correspondence
Required SkillsLeadership, organizational, and management skillsCommunication, organization, and multitasking skills
Work EnvironmentTypically supervises staff and manages office systemsSupports executives and team members directly
Common CertificationsOffice management or business administration certificationsAdministrative assistant or secretarial certifications

The main difference is that Office Managers oversee overall office operations and staff, while Administrative Assistants focus on supporting individual teams or executives with administrative tasks. Both roles require strong organizational skills, but Office Managers often have broader responsibilities and leadership duties.

Who gets paid more, administrator or manager?

In general, office managers tend to earn higher salaries than administrative assistants or administrators because they have greater responsibilities, oversee staff, and often require more experience or management skills. Salary differences can vary based on industry, location, and company size, but managers typically have higher pay due to their leadership roles. Certifications and experience can also influence salary levels for both positions.
